Information
  • 30 minute flight experience
  • Allow one hour total time for each ride
  • Flights must be booked with at least 48 hours prior notice *Weekends and holidays may require extra lead time*
  • Flights may be rescheduled due to poor weather conditions or pilot availability
  • Call within 24 hours of scheduled flight for confirmation
  • Arrive 30 minutes prior to your rider
  • Please wear tennis shoes
  • Rider weight limit is 250 lbs.
  • Passengers must be 18 years old or older.

    The Cavanaugh Flight Museum is a non-profit 501(c)(3) educational organization devoted to promoting aviation studies and to perpetuating America's aviation heritage; the museum fulfills its mission by restoring, operating, maintaining and displaying historically-significant, vintage aircraft, and by collecting materials related to the history of aviation.
